Onboarding note — Facilities desk, Grelling & Moss Partners

Reception is moving from level 1 to the ground-floor atrium this quarter. Facilities desk handles the transition: relocate the visitor kiosk, reroute courier deliveries, and update lobby signage. The level 1 counter closes once the atrium desk is live. Expect extra calls during the first week — log them all in Fixtrack. Contractors fitting the new desk need access to the atrium service corridor. Grant entry with this door-pass code:

staff pass of kagup-fajog = bdg-QCHVQW-99665837

### The baseline file, explained

Welcome aboard! You'll notice `lintbase.yaml` at the repo root — that's our Greymoor static-analysis baseline. It freezes ~1,400 legacy findings so CI only yells about *new* issues. Don't hand-edit it; run `greymoor baseline --refresh` after intentional cleanups, and mention it in your PR description. The refresh command also syncs suppression records to our findings database, which it reaches using the connection string below.

primary connection of tajeg-tajop = postgresql://julax_svc:DI@db-e7f3.kelvidyn.corp:5432/rusdor

☐ Cold storage archival — Driftmere buckets

Confirm that all Driftmere cold storage buckets older than 18 months were moved to the Vaultline archive tier, that lifecycle rules show a completed run within the last 30 days, and that restore tests succeeded for two sampled buckets. If any check fails, escalate directly to the accountable owner listed below.

account owner for tahag-yagaf: Belys Gordor

// Client setup for the Quillgate config service.
// This client subscribes to the hot-reload channel so config changes
// propagate without a restart. Reviewers: note that reload events are
// debounced at 500ms to avoid thrashing when Opsweave pushes bulk
// updates. Validation happens before swap; a bad payload keeps the
// previous snapshot active and logs a warning. Do not add blocking
// calls inside the reload callback — it runs on the watcher thread.
// The client authenticates to Quillgate with the key below.

API key for yahig-tadup: kto7_ubizbYm